Birdie Tebbetts died March 24, 1999, in Manatee, FL, USA.
Birdie Tebbetts was born November 10, 1912, in Burlington, VT, USA.
Birdie Tebbets's birth name is George Robert Tebbetts.
Birdie Tebbetts is 5 feet 11 inches tall. He weighs 170 pounds. He bats right and throws right.
Birdie Tebbetts debuted on September 16, 1936, playing for the Detroit Tigers at Navin Field; he played his final game on September 14, 1952, playing for the Cleveland Indians at Cleveland Stadium.
Birdie Tebbetts played in 37 games at catcher for the Cleveland Indians in 1952, starting in none of them. He made 131 putouts, had 15 assists, and committed 2 errors, equivalent to .054 errors per game (estimate based on total games played in). He had no double plays.
In 1936, Birdie Tebbetts played in 10 games, all for the Detroit Tigers, and batting in all of them. He had 33 at bats, getting 10 hits, for a .303 batting average, with 4 runs batted in. He was walked 5 times. He struck out 3 times. He hit 1 double, 2 triples, and 1 home run.
In 1951, Birdie Tebbetts played in 55 games, all for the Cleveland Indians, and batting in all of them. He had 137 at bats, getting 36 hits, for a .263 batting average, with 18 runs batted in. He was walked 8 times, and was hit by the pitch 1 time. He struck out 7 times. He hit 6 doubles, 0 triples, and 2 home runs.
